Output e86ad7fcc60081e9c9d209150718283185fd9e5229c92c1e252d0d920e368104:65

value
80479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f269c5c0f6aeb4bafa784d68b2697b0cec91898 OP_EQUAL
address
3358K9NmDQBCmEHKrTZktSYQUrFP4PhG37
transaction
e86ad7fcc60081e9c9d209150718283185fd9e5229c92c1e252d0d920e368104
spent
true